A bundle is an item that can store up to a stack's worth of mixed item types within itself in a single inventory slot. Items that stack to less than 64 occupy more space within the bundle, and items that do not stack occupy the entire bundle without allowing space for any other items.

Dyed bundles are the dyed variants of bundles.

Usage[edit | edit source]

Item stack sizes (top row) and the number of bundle slots they take up (middle row). Sticks stack to 64, so they take up one bundle slot; ender pearls stack to 16, so they take up four; and swords do not stack, so they take up the whole bundle. So, for instance, a bundle may have 32 sticks and 8 ender pearls inside, which take up a total of (32×1)+(8×4)=64 bundle slots.

Bundles are used to store different item types in the same inventory slot. This does not, however, increase the total capacity of the slot, as bundles can only store what adds up to a single slot. Items that can normally stack up to 64 take up 1/64 of a bundle, items that can normally stack up to 16 (eg. eggs) take up 1/16 of a bundle, and items that can't stack take up the entirety of a bundle (with exception to bundles themselves). On Java Edition, space that an item takes up in a bundle is equal to the reciprocal of its max_stack_size component, even if it is different from the standard 1, 16, and 64.

Bundles are not stackable, but they are able to be placed (nested) inside another[1], and will always take up 1/16 of the space of a bundle, regardless of their max_stack_size component, plus the space occupied by the inner bundle's contents.

Shulker boxes cannot be placed inside of bundles. However, bundles can be placed inside of shulker boxes.

Inserting and retrieving[edit | edit source]

Items are inserted into bundles by left-clicking, and retrieved by right-clicking.

To place items inside a bundle, either (1) pick up the bundle in the inventory and left-click on the item(s) to be placed inside or (2) pick up the item(s) and left-click on the bundle. When placing a bundle inside another bundle, the interface uses the first method: picking up bundle A and right clicking on bundle B attempts to store bundle B inside A.

Items can be retrieved from bundles in one of five ways:

  • Right-clicking on bundles in an inventory, without holding anything with the cursor, will cause the cursor to hold the item from the most recently added slot of the bundle.
  • Scrolling on bundles in an inventory allows for scrolling through the bundle's slots, which starts off as the most recently added slot, and is displayed with a bright underlay behind that slot. During this process, the bundle's icon will appear open, and the selected slot's item icon will appear within the bundle's icon, though this is not shown in the player's hand. If the bundle is right-clicked while in this state, the currently selected item will move to the cursor and the bundle will close. If the cursor is moved off the bundle while it's still open, the bundle will close.
  • Right-clicking on bundles in an inventory while they are held in the cursor and are hovering over an empty slot where can be placed will cause that item to be placed in that slot.
  • Using a bundle while it is selected in the hotbar will cause the contents of the most recently added slot to be thrown out in the direction the player is facing.
  • When a bundle item entity is destroyed, the contents of the bundle are dropped as items, similar to when a shulker box is destroyed.

GUI[edit | edit source]

Hovering over a quarter-full bundle with 16 items.

Hovering over a bundle reveals its blue fullness bar. When the bundle is empty, the fullness bar says "Empty" and shows the description, "Can hold a mixed stack of items". If it's completely full, the fullness bar turns red and says "Full". When there is at least one item in a bundle, space will open up above the bar, which displays the items in the bundle's slots, sorted by how recently they were added, from right to left. The space where the slots are shown is only wide enough for four slots, so additional space opens up for new rows. When there are more than three rows, only the top three will be displayed, and the bottom-right slot will be replaced by text that says, +<number of slots hidden>, where the slot replaced by the text counts toward that number.

Bundles show an additional fullness bar on their icons, in a similar way to how items that take damage show their durability. Bundle fullness bars are blue, or red when full, and appear when the bundle contains at least one item.

History[edit | edit source]

October 3, 2020 Bundles are revealed at Minecraft Live 2020. Hovering over them shows all items inside scattered around a large area, and incomplete bundles have the empty texture.
October 16, 2021Ulraf states that bundles are not included in Caves & Cliffs.
November 17, 2021Bundles are announced to be added after The Wild Update.
September 28, 2024Bundles are announced to be added in the Bundles of Bravery drop.
[hide]Java Edition
1.1720w45a Added bundles. Hovering over them shows some of the items contained and their quantities, much like the tooltip of a shulker box. Incomplete bundles have the full texture.
The crafting recipe was originally 2 strings and 6 rabbit hides.
20w46a The textures of bundles have been changed.
Hovering over bundles now shows its contained items in special slots, similar to slots in the inventory. If the bundle is not full, it also has an empty slot with a plus on it.
20w48aBundles now show fullness as a number when advanced tooltips are enabled.
Using a bundle in the inventory now empties one item from the bundle instead of emptying all the contents out to the inventory.
Using a bundle now throws out its entire content into the world.
20w49aBundle fullness is now always shown.
Full bundles now show the blue bar instead of hiding it, to distinguish from empty bundles.
20w51aBundles now drop its contents when destroyed as an item entity.
Bundle fullness has been changed from Fullness: <fullness> / 64 to <fullness>/64
The slots in the tooltip when hovering over bundles have changed to have a border, and rows of slot have a thicker edge between them.
When the bundle is not full, it instead shows empty slots instead of one slot with a plus. When it is full, those empty slots become greyed out with an X.
21w05aThe player now receives a tutorial when first having a bundle in the inventory.
21w19aBundles are now accessible only through commands.
1.18Experimental Snapshot 1Bundles are now available in the creative inventory and can be crafted once again.
21w37aBundles are once again accessible only through commands.

Trivia[edit | edit source]

  • Bundles are inspired by the ancient Roman coin purse, which have been used for thousands of years.[2]
  • The reason for why bundles can be dyed in 16 colors rather than a combination of multiple colors (like leather armor) is that Mojang considered it more important for players to be able to quickly identify the color of the bundle rather than being able to fully customize the color.[3]
  • Bundles are the first non-block item that uses the 16 color dyes versus the 2^24 leather dye system.[4]
  • Bundle is the last feature announced at Minecraft Live 2020 to be released. Minecraft Live 2020 took place on October 3, 2020 with the bundles announced for the Caves & Cliffs update while Bundles of Bravery was not released until 4 years and 19 days later on October 22, 2024.
